带iOS系统的模拟器是一种软件工具,能在非iOS设备上创建和运行iOS环境,模拟iOS操作系统的界面、功能和性能。它为开发者、测试人员及爱好者提供了在非苹果设备上体验和测试iOS应用的平台,解决了硬件获取成本高、设备数量有限的实际问题。
模拟器具备多设备模拟能力,支持不同型号的iOS设备,如iPhone、iPad、Apple TV等,模拟其屏幕尺寸、分辨率和硬件特性。同时,它提供完整的iOS API访问,允许开发者调试和测试应用的功能、性能及兼容性,确保应用在不同iOS版本上的稳定运行。例如,开发者可通过模拟器测试应用在不同iOS系统版本下的响应速度、内存占用和界面显示效果,提前发现并修复潜在问题。
对于开发者而言,模拟器降低了开发和测试成本,无需购买多台iOS设备,节省了硬件投入和时间。对于测试人员,它能快速模拟各种iOS场景,如不同网络环境(Wi-Fi、蜂窝数据)、系统版本(iOS 14至iOS 17)、设备状态(充电、低电量、多任务处理),提升测试效率。此外,模拟器也常用于学习和教学,帮助初学者理解iOS开发流程和系统架构,通过实践操作掌握编程技能。
在软件开发领域,模拟器是移动应用开发流程中的关键环节,尤其在应用发布前,用于全面测试功能、性能和兼容性。在内容创作领域,创作者可使用模拟器预览和调整iOS应用内的内容,如界面设计、交互逻辑、动画效果等,确保内容符合目标设备的使用习惯。教育领域则利用模拟器开展iOS相关课程,让学生在真实模拟环境中实践编程和调试技能,增强学习效果。
使用模拟器时需注意硬件性能要求,低配置设备可能导致模拟器运行缓慢或崩溃。同时,需关注模拟器的系统版本兼容性,确保模拟的iOS版本与目标设备一致,避免因版本差异导致的测试结果偏差。此外,部分模拟器可能存在法律或版权问题,用户在使用前需确认合规性,避免侵犯知识产权,确保合法使用。